    What Is Augmented Reality Navigation?

    Augmented Reality Navigation in the Mercedes-Benz EQS uses cutting-edge technology to project essential driving information directly onto your windshield. Instead of relying solely on a GPS screen, AR overlays turn-by-turn directions, lane guidance, and even distance markers in your field of vision.

    How It Works:

    1. Sensors and Cameras: The car has sensors and cameras that monitor your surroundings in real-time.
    2. Head-Up Display (HUD): The HUD projects dynamic images onto the windshield, ensuring key navigation details are visible without distractions.
    3. Central Processing Unit (CPU): This powerful processor syncs real-world data with navigation prompts to provide accurate, seamless guidance.

    Key Features of Mercedes-Benz EQS AR Navigation

    Mercedes-Benz has designed its AR navigation to be user-friendly, intuitive, and packed with features. Here are some standout components:

    AR Display on the Windshield

    The system projects a virtual image onto the windshield that appears as if floating ahead of the vehicle. This makes navigation easy and minimizes the need to glance at other screens.

    Key Information Displayed:

    • Turn-by-turn arrows for navigation.
    • Lane guidance for upcoming exits or merges.
    • Markers for detected vehicles ahead, assisting with distance regulation.

    Integration with Driver Assistance Systems

    AR navigation is fully integrated with Mercedes-Benz’s advanced driver assistance systems, like Active Distance Assist DISTRONIC and Active Lane Keeping Assist.

    How This Helps You:

    • Ensures safe following distances by marking the vehicle ahead.
    • Displays arrows to highlight when and where to change lanes.

    Customizable HUD Settings

    You can personalize your HUD to fit your preferences. Adjustments include:

    • Positioning: Align the display with your eye level.
    • Brightness: Optimize visibility based on lighting conditions.
    • Content: Choose what information appears, such as navigation, speed, and assistance alerts.

    Real-Time Navigation Accuracy

    The system dynamically updates navigation instructions thanks to GPS and live data from cameras. This ensures the AR overlays match the road environment with minimal delays.

    How to Use Mercedes-Benz EQS AR Navigation

    Getting started with the AR navigation system is straightforward. Follow these steps to make the most of it:

    Activate Navigation

    • Select the “Navigation” option on your MBUX touchscreen display.
    • Enter your destination or use voice commands to set a route.

    Customize AR Settings

    • Go to “Navigation Settings” and choose “Augmented Reality.”
    • Adjust the display options, such as brightness and positioning.

    Start Driving

    • Watch for arrows, lane markers, and vehicle indicators projected on your windshield as you drive.
    • Follow these cues for smooth and accurate navigation.
